By transforming the differential problem into an equivalent integral problem \\( u = T u, \\) where \\(T\\) is a suitable integral operator, the author proves two theorems (for \\(f(t,u)\\) and \\(f(t,u,u')\\)) providing sufficient conditions on the nonlinear function \\(f\\) and the constants to ensure the existence of a concave solution. Further, a fixed-point iteration \\(u_{n+1}= T u_n\\) with given \\(u_0\\) is proposed to approximate the solution of the integral equation. Finally, two examples with some polynomial functions \\(f\\) are presented to show the performance of the proposed iterative scheme.","citation":[{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1206873"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1329284"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1336190"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1353743"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q4264050"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1586281"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1612558"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q4798730"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q4463142"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1767827"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1400092"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q4796749"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1406111"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1767836"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q4465269"},{"@id":"https://portal.mardi4nfdi.de/entity/Q1764500"}]},"provenance":{"prov:generatedAtTime":"2026-01-10T15:53:41Z","prov:wasAttributedTo":"MaRDI Knowledge Graph"}}
